Barbourville, KY – The Delta College baseball team opened the 2019 season in Kentucky on Thursday, as they battled Union College in a double-header. Game one saw the Pioneers win, 8-4 while game two ended in a 9-9 after the game was called due to rain.
Delta jumped on the board first in game with a single run in the second inning before putting up three more in the third to take a 4-0 lead. Kyle Belger, Cam Fowler, Matt Fisher and Evan Pocius all strong together hits to account for the runs. Union cut the lead in half in the bottom of the fourth before Delta put the game away with four runs of their own in the sixth and seventh. Union made one last claim at the win by putting up two in the seventh and had the bases loaded before Alex Snider came on to pick up his first save of the season.
Alex Dingee (1-0) picked up the win on the hill for Delta after throwing 5.2 innings and giving up two earned runs on three hits with give strikeouts. Evan Pocius had a big game on offense for Delta with two hits and five RBI while Fowler and Belger each two hits and two runs.
Game two saw Delta put up a five-spot in the first inning and jump out to a 9-3 lead heading in to the bottom of the sixth. Union stormed back, however, putting up six runs on two hits, two walks and two hit batters to tie the game at 9-9. With neither team scoring in the seventh and the rain coming down, the game was called.
Jack Rossbach (0-1) took the loss in relief of starting pitcher Connor Moe who threw 5.1 innings and giving up three runs on three hits while striking our four. Jeff Allen led the DC offense with three hits and two runs while Nolan Raymond collected three hits and two RBI.
